Plan Your Visit Around Peak Times

One of the best ways to ensure a smooth DMV visit in San Diego is to plan your visit around peak times. Typically, the DMV is busiest during lunch hours and towards the end of the month when people rush to complete their tasks. To avoid long waits, consider visiting during mid-morning or mid-afternoon on weekdays.

Additionally, seasonal changes can affect wait times. For instance, the summer months often see an influx of new drivers and college students seeking licenses and permits. Planning your visit during less busy seasons can help you avoid crowds and save time.

Utilize Online Services

Many DMV services can be handled online, eliminating the need for an in-person visit altogether. Before heading to the DMV, check their website to see if you can complete your task online. Common services like registration renewals, address changes, and even some license renewals are available digitally.

By using online services, you not only save yourself time but also help reduce congestion at the physical locations, contributing to a smoother experience for everyone involved.

Prepare Your Documentation

Before heading out, ensure you have all necessary documentation organized and ready. This preparation includes identification, proof of residence, and any required forms specific to your service request. Double-checking your documents can prevent unnecessary delays and repeated trips.

For those unsure of what documents are needed, visit the DMV website for a comprehensive checklist. This simple step can save you a significant amount of time and frustration.

Consider Alternative Locations

San Diego residents have access to multiple DMV locations. Some branches may be less busy than others, depending on their size and location. Exploring alternative branches might lead to shorter wait times and a more efficient visit.

Keep in mind that some services require appointments, which can be scheduled online. Booking an appointment ensures that you are seen promptly upon arrival, allowing you to bypass walk-in wait lines.
